INET Framework for OMNeT++/OMNEST
inet::Packet Member List

This is the complete list of members for inet::Packet, including all inherited members.

_getRegionTag(int index)inet::Packetinlineprotected
_getTag(int index)inet::Packetinlineprotected
addRegionTag(b offset=b(0), b length=b(-1))inet::Packetinline
addRegionTagIfAbsent(b offset=b(0), b length=b(-1))inet::Packetinline
addRegionTagsWhereAbsent(b offset=b(0), b length=b(-1))inet::Packetinline
addTag()inet::Packetinline
addTagIfAbsent()inet::Packetinline
backIteratorinet::Packetprotected
clearRegionTags(b offset=b(0), b length=b(-1))inet::Packetinline
clearTags()inet::Packetinline
contentinet::Packetprotected
copyRegionTags(const Packet &source, b sourceOffset=b(0), b offset=b(0), b length=b(-1))inet::Packetinline
copyTags(const Packet &source)inet::Packetinline
decapsulate() overrideinet::Packetinlinevirtual
dup() const overrideinet::Packetinlinevirtual
encapsulate(cPacket *packet) overrideinet::Packetinlinevirtual
eraseAll()inet::Packetinline
eraseAt(b offset, b length)inet::Packet
eraseAtBack(b length)inet::Packetinline
eraseAtFront(b length)inet::Packetinline
eraseData()inet::Packetinline
eraseDataAt(b offset, b length)inet::Packetinline
findRegionTag(b offset=b(0), b length=b(-1)) constinet::Packetinline
findTag() constinet::Packetinline
findTagForUpdate()inet::Packetinline
forEachChild(cVisitor *v) overrideinet::Packetvirtual
frontIteratorinet::Packetprotected
getAllRegionTags(b offset=b(0), b length=b(-1)) constinet::Packetinline
getAllRegionTagsForUpdate(b offset=b(0), b length=b(-1))inet::Packetinline
getBack() constinet::Packetprotected
getBackOffset() constinet::Packetinline
getBitLength() const overrideinet::Packetinlinevirtual
getCompleteStringRepresentation(int evFlags=0) constinet::IPrintableObjectinlinevirtual
getContent() constinet::Packetinlineprotected
getData() constinet::Packetprotected
getDataLength() constinet::Packetinline
getDebugStringRepresentation(int evFlags=0) constinet::IPrintableObjectinlinevirtual
getDetailStringRepresentation(int evFlags=0) constinet::IPrintableObjectinlinevirtual
getDissection() constinet::Packetprotected
getEncapsulatedPacket() const overrideinet::Packetinlinevirtual
getFront() constinet::Packetprotected
getFrontOffset() constinet::Packetinline
getFullName() const overrideinet::Packetvirtual
getInfoStringRepresentation(int evFlags=0) constinet::IPrintableObjectinlinevirtual
getNumRegionTags() constinet::Packetinline
getNumTags() constinet::Packetinline
getRegionTag(int index) constinet::Packetinline
getRegionTag(b offset=b(0), b length=b(-1)) constinet::Packetinline
getRegionTags() overrideinet::Packetinlinevirtual
getTag(int index) constinet::Packetinline
getTag() constinet::Packetinline
getTagForUpdate()inet::Packetinline
getTags() overrideinet::Packetinlinevirtual
getTotalLength() constinet::Packetinline
getTraceStringRepresentation(int evFlags=0) constinet::IPrintableObjectinlinevirtual
hasAll() constinet::Packetinline
hasAt(b offset, b length=b(-1)) constinet::Packetinline
hasAtBack(b length) constinet::Packetinline
hasAtFront(b length=b(-1)) constinet::Packetinline
hasBitError() const overrideinet::Packetinlinevirtual
hasData() constinet::Packetinline
hasDataAt(b offset, b length=b(-1)) constinet::Packetinline
insertAll(const Ptr< const Chunk > &chunk)inet::Packetinline
insertAt(const Ptr< const Chunk > &chunk, b offset)inet::Packet
insertAtBack(const Ptr< const Chunk > &chunk)inet::Packetinline
insertAtFront(const Ptr< const Chunk > &chunk)inet::Packetinline
insertData(const Ptr< const Chunk > &chunk)inet::Packetinline
insertDataAt(const Ptr< const Chunk > &chunk, b offset)inet::Packetinline
isConsistent()inet::Packetinlineprotected
isIteratorConsistent(const Chunk::Iterator &iterator)inet::Packetinlineprotected
mapAllRegionTags(b offset, b length, std::function< void(b, b, const Ptr< const T > &)> f) constinet::Packetinline
mapAllRegionTagsForUpdate(b offset, b length, std::function< void(b, b, const Ptr< T > &)> f)inet::Packetinline
Packet(const char *name=nullptr, short kind=0)inet::Packetexplicit
Packet(const char *name, const Ptr< const Chunk > &content)inet::Packet
Packet(const Packet &other)inet::Packet
PacketDescriptor classinet::Packetfriend
parsimPack(cCommBuffer *buffer) const overrideinet::Packetvirtual
parsimUnpack(cCommBuffer *buffer) overrideinet::Packetvirtual
peekAll(int flags=0) constinet::Packetinline
peekAll(int flags=0) constinet::Packetinline
peekAllAsBits(int flags=0) constinet::Packetinline
peekAllAsBytes(int flags=0) constinet::Packetinline
peekAt(b offset, b length=b(-1), int flags=0) constinet::Packetinline
peekAt(b offset, b length=b(-1), int flags=0) constinet::Packetinline
peekAtBack(b length=b(-1), int flags=0) constinet::Packetinline
peekAtBack(b length, int flags=0) constinet::Packetinline
peekAtFront(b length=b(-1), int flags=0) constinet::Packetinline
peekAtFront(b length=b(-1), int flags=0) constinet::Packetinline
peekData(int flags=0) constinet::Packetinline
peekData(int flags=0) constinet::Packetinline
peekDataAsBits(int flags=0) constinet::Packetinline
peekDataAsBytes(int flags=0) constinet::Packetinline
peekDataAt(b offset, b length=b(-1), int flags=0) constinet::Packetinline
peekDataAt(b offset, b length=b(-1), int flags=0) constinet::Packetinline
popAtBack(b length=b(-1), int flags=0)inet::Packetinline
popAtBack(b length, int flags=0)inet::Packetinline
popAtFront(b length=b(-1), int flags=0)inet::Packetinline
popAtFront(b length=b(-1), int flags=0)inet::Packetinline
PRINT_FLAG_FORMATTED enum valueinet::IPrintableObject
PRINT_FLAG_MULTILINE enum valueinet::IPrintableObject
PRINT_LEVEL_COMPLETE enum valueinet::IPrintableObject
PRINT_LEVEL_DEBUG enum valueinet::IPrintableObject
PRINT_LEVEL_DETAIL enum valueinet::IPrintableObject
PRINT_LEVEL_INFO enum valueinet::IPrintableObject
PRINT_LEVEL_TRACE enum valueinet::IPrintableObject
PrintFlag enum nameinet::IPrintableObject
PrintLevel enum nameinet::IPrintableObject
printToStream(std::ostream &stream, int level, int evFlags=0) const overrideinet::Packetvirtual
printToString() constinet::IPrintableObjectinlinevirtual
printToString(int level, int evFlags=0) constinet::IPrintableObjectinlinevirtual
regionTagsinet::Packetprotected
removeAll(int flags=0)inet::Packetinline
removeAll(int flags=0)inet::Packetinline
removeAt(b offset, b length=b(-1), int flags=0)inet::Packetinline
removeAt(b offset, b length=b(-1), int flags=0)inet::Packetinline
removeAtBack(b length=b(-1), int flags=0)inet::Packetinline
removeAtBack(b length, int flags=0)inet::Packetinline
removeAtFront(b length=b(-1), int flags=0)inet::Packetinline
removeAtFront(b length=b(-1), int flags=0)inet::Packetinline
removeData(int flags=0)inet::Packetinline
removeData(int flags=0)inet::Packetinline
removeDataAt(b offset, b length=b(-1), int flags=0)inet::Packetinline
removeDataAt(b offset, b length=b(-1), int flags=0)inet::Packetinline
removeRegionTag(b offset, b length)inet::Packetinline
removeRegionTagIfPresent(b offset, b length)inet::Packetinline
removeRegionTagsWherePresent(b offset, b length)inet::Packetinline
removeTag()inet::Packetinline
removeTagIfPresent()inet::Packetinline
replaceAll(const Ptr< const Chunk > &chunk, int flags=0)inet::Packetinline
replaceAll(const Ptr< const Chunk > &chunk, int flags=0)inet::Packetinline
replaceAt(const Ptr< const Chunk > &chunk, b offset, b length=b(-1), int flags=0)inet::Packetinline
replaceAt(const Ptr< const Chunk > &chunk, b offset, b length=b(-1), int flags=0)inet::Packetinline
replaceAtBack(const Ptr< const Chunk > &chunk, b length=b(-1), int flags=0)inet::Packetinline
replaceAtBack(const Ptr< const Chunk > &chunk, b length, int flags=0)inet::Packetinline
replaceAtFront(const Ptr< const Chunk > &chunk, b length=b(-1), int flags=0)inet::Packetinline
replaceAtFront(const Ptr< const Chunk > &chunk, b length=b(-1), int flags=0)inet::Packetinline
replaceData(const Ptr< const Chunk > &chunk, int flags=0)inet::Packetinline
replaceData(const Ptr< const Chunk > &chunk, int flags=0)inet::Packetinline
replaceDataAt(const Ptr< const Chunk > &chunk, b offset, b length=b(-1), int flags=0)inet::Packetinline
replaceDataAt(const Ptr< const Chunk > &chunk, b offset, b length=b(-1), int flags=0)inet::Packetinline
setBackOffset(b offset)inet::Packet
setBitLength(int64_t value) overrideinet::Packetinlinevirtual
setControlInfo(cObject *p) overrideinet::Packetinlinevirtual
setFrontOffset(b offset)inet::Packet
str() const overrideinet::Packetvirtual
tagsinet::Packetprotected
totalLengthinet::Packetprotected
trim()inet::Packet
trimBack()inet::Packet
trimFront()inet::Packet
updateAll(std::function< void(const Ptr< Chunk > &)> f, int flags=0)inet::Packetinline
updateAll(std::function< void(const Ptr< T > &)> f, int flags=0)inet::Packetinline
updateAt(std::function< void(const Ptr< Chunk > &)> f, b offset, b length=b(-1), int flags=0)inet::Packetinline
updateAt(std::function< void(const Ptr< T > &)> f, b offset, b length=b(-1), int flags=0)inet::Packetinline
updateAtBack(std::function< void(const Ptr< Chunk > &)> f, b length=b(-1), int flags=0)inet::Packetinline
updateAtBack(std::function< void(const Ptr< T > &)> f, b length, int flags=0)inet::Packetinline
updateAtFront(std::function< void(const Ptr< Chunk > &)> f, b length=b(-1), int flags=0)inet::Packetinline
updateAtFront(std::function< void(const Ptr< T > &)> f, b length=b(-1), int flags=0)inet::Packetinline
updateData(std::function< void(const Ptr< Chunk > &)> f, int flags=0)inet::Packetinline
updateData(std::function< void(const Ptr< T > &)> f, int flags=0)inet::Packetinline
updateDataAt(std::function< void(const Ptr< Chunk > &)> f, b offset, b length=b(-1), int flags=0)inet::Packetinline
updateDataAt(std::function< void(const Ptr< T > &)> f, b offset, b length=b(-1), int flags=0)inet::Packetinline
~IPrintableObject()inet::IPrintableObjectinlinevirtual